2012 Award for the Advancement of Women in OR/MS

Call for Nominations

The Award for the Advancement of Women in OR/MS celebrates and recognizes a person who has contributed significantly to the advancement and recognition of women in the field of Operations Research and the Management Sciences (OR/MS). Each nominee will be considered based on his or her history of successfully promoting the professional development, success, and recognition of women in OR/MS. Nominees can have made contributions in multiple ways, such as primarily at their own institutions, through involvement in professional organizations, etc.

Examples of activities to be considered include, but are not limited to, the following: personal commitment and/or leadership with respect to increased hiring, retention, advancement, and recognition of women (students and faculty) in academia, industry, or government; leadership in encouraging, sponsoring, and/or developing professional training/development programs for women in OR/MS; creating an environment that supports women’s full participation and advancement in the field of OR/MS, possibly through mentoring, leadership, financial support, and/or personal investment of time.

Application process

Nominations should include:

  • Nominee's name, affiliation, address, telephone, fax, e-mail;
  • A short (250-500 words) description of the nominee’s overall contribution to the advancement of the careers of women in OR/MS; Description(s) of specific activities, programs, leadership;
  • Statements of support from women in OR/MS and/or from organizations which observed or benefited from the nominee’s activities; The nominee’s résumé and other items as appropriate.

All nominations must be submitted via e-mail to the Award Committee Chair, Ana Muriel, by July 1, 2012. One award (in the form of a plaque) will be given, if there is a suitable candidate. The award will be presented to the winner during the 2012 INFORMS National Meeting in Phoenix, AZ.

Past Winners of the Award for the Advancement of Women in OR/MS:

2011 Award Winner Berna Dengiz    
     
 
     
2010 Award Winner Brenda Dietrich 2009 Award Winner Alice Smith  
     
 
     
2008 Award Winner Candace (Candi) Yano    
     
 
     

2007 Award Winner Anna Nagurney

 

2006 Award Winner Radhika Kularni

2005 Award Winners Cindy Barnhart and Jane Ammons
